Medslike.com is an online pharmacy based in Surat, India, selling generic prescription drugs like ED medications, antibiotics, and antiparasitics without requiring prescriptions. It claims FDA approval, global certifications, and secure shipping, but lacks verifiable licensing details from Indian authorities.
Trust Ratings
Trustpilot shows a 3.9/5 rating from 176 reviews, with praise for product quality, customer service, and discreet packaging. However, common complaints include shipping delays (up to 44 days), non-delivery (especially to Europe), crushed packages, and refund issues. The company responds to 66% of negatives but doesn’t always resolve problems like failed deliveries to Switzerland or Germany.
Red Flags
No evidence of a legitimate Indian drug license for Surat operations, required under Drugs and Cosmetics Act for pharmacies. Domain registered since 2020 via Cloudflare, hiding owner details, which is common for questionable sites. Sells controlled substances like Ivermectin and Albendazole without prescriptions, raising legality concerns in many countries including Spain. Isolated scam accusations exist, including counterfeit claims and payment via “weird fake business names.”
Recommendations
Approach with high caution—risks include fake meds, customs seizures, or lost money due to poor shipping. Use licensed local pharmacies in Murcia or consult a doctor for prescriptions; avoid international sites without verified credentials. No BBB or major scam reports, but mixed experiences suggest it’s not fully trustworthy.
